What Are ACH Deals?

An ACH deal is a digital transfer of cash between accounts at various financial institutions. With an ACH purchase, you can securely obtain or send out cash between your bank as well as one more. Organizations frequently use ACH purchases to streamline payroll with direct deposits, pay billings, and approve consumer payments.

Just How ACH Transactions Job

ACH represents Automated Cleaning Residence which is an electronic fund transfer system that financial institutions use to process payments.

The process begins when a financial institution’s consumer makes an ACH transfer. The consumer goes into the routing and account variety of whomever they’re paying. The information related to that deal is then sent to the ACH network. On the network, the consumer’s transaction is accumulated along with all the various other ACH transactions.

3 times each organization day, the ACH network refines its most recent set of ACH purchases. Whether you recognize it or not, you likely make use of ACH deals routinely.

If you have actually ever transferred a consult on your phone, obtained a straight down payment, or used internal revenue service Direct Pay, you have actually used an ACH system.

The Advantages and disadvantages of ACH Deals

Pros of ACH Purchases:

1. Easy to set up

One of the large reasons more than 93 percent of U.S. employees get paid using straight deposit is ACH’s ease of use. With the appropriate know-how and software, you can automate your payroll making use of the straight deposit. For various other business purchases, ACH is also less complicated to make use of. To pay someone, all you require is a checking account with ACH and also your payee’s account and transmitting number.

2. Secure

The ACH is government-controlled and handled by the National Automated Clearing Up Residence (NACHA). So as long as you collaborate with payment processors and financial institutions that use residential property safety and security methods, ACH is really secure.

3. Affordable

In a lot of scenarios, ACH is the most budget-friendly way to pay or make money. In fact, with the accounting software program, any entrepreneur can set up as well as automated rent payments through ACH. Once it’s established, the regular cost for ACH payments is between $0.20 as well as $1.50 per purchase.

Disadvantages of ACH Purchases:

4. Slow

Contrasted to a real-time alternative like a cord transfer, ACH transfers are slow-moving. Distribution time with ACH can be same-day yet if it’s offered– which isn’t guaranteed– it will certainly set you back additional.

Usually, ACH transactions are processed as well as provided within one or two business days. Nonetheless, different financial institutions may call for the funds to be held for an amount of time. Finally, considering that it’s closed on weekends, ACH can wind up taking a number of days.

5. Inappropriate for abroad transactions

Since ACH is primarily used in the United States, worldwide ACH transactions are extra made complex. Essentially, because different countries use systems other than ACH to procedure digital settlements between financial institutions, ACH deals do not function throughout boundaries.

That stated, global ACH purchases are feasible– they’re just much more pricey and difficult.

6. Fees, limits, and cutoff times

Relying on your organization savings account, you’ll have every day as well as a regular monthly cap on the quantity of cash you relocate using ACH. Additionally, if you attempt to make a payment without enough money, you might sustain an inadequate funds charge. Finally, ACH deals aren’t refined during the weekend break which is bothersome if you need to spend cash on a Friday afternoon.

Last Note: ACH Purchases vs. Cable Transfers

ACH deals and also wire transfers appear fairly similar. After all, they both include moving cash from one financial institution or bank to an additional one. Unlike ACH transactions, however, cable transfers don’t involve a clearinghouse. Rather, when you wire money, it goes directly to the recipient’s financial institution in real time.

As an entrepreneur, the crucial distinctions between ACH and also wire transfers are cost, rate, and also safety, and security. Wire transfers normally cost between $20 and also $30 for the sender and also $10 for the receiver. However, as mentioned, a cable transfer is completed in real-time.

Moreover, contrasted to ACH transactions, wire transfers are somewhat less protected because they do not include a clearinghouse.

Basically, cord transfers are better booked for huge or immediate deals. For predictable, high-volume transactions, like vendor billings, payroll, or customer payments, ACH is the settlement approach of selection.
